Abstract :
We construct a consistent reduction of type IIA supergravity on S3, leading to a maximal gauged supergravity in seven dimensions with the full set of massless SO(4) Yang–Mills fields. We do this by starting with the known S4 reduction of eleven-dimensional supergravity, and showing that it is possible to take a singular limit of the resulting standard SO(5)-gauged maximal supergravity in seven dimensions, whose eleven-dimensional interpretation involves taking a limit where the internal 4-sphere degenerates to R×S3. This allows us to reinterpret the limiting SO(4)-gauged theory in seven dimensions as the S3 reduction of type IIA supergravity. We also obtain the consistent S4 reduction of type IIA supergravity, which gives an SO(5)-gauged maximal supergravity in D=6.
